[Bug 198531] Re: Connecting to SSH or Samba server gives The specified location is not mounted error

2008-09-04 Thread finkey
In current updated Ubuntu Hardy,

On connect to Windows Shares Server, an error box pops up that says
Can't display location...The specified location is not mounted.  But
whoops, there it was, right on the desktop, no problem showing the
shares.  Lucky, my settings are to show mounted deviices.  Otherwise,
I'd believe the message.

Thank goodness for Connect to Server.  The Network icon in Places can't
detect the Windows Share Server at all!  But it does detect my Ubuntu PC
in a separate WORKGROUP.  Using Configuration Editor to change the
value of /System/smb to the same name as Windows Workgroup in order to
join it, didn't change a thing.

For now I have bookmarked the location, and rely on that to get over to the 
Windows Share Server.
Thanks for your kind attention.   If you know where to find the fix mentioned 
above, please point me to it.

[Bug 198531] Re: Connecting to SSH or Samba server gives The specified location is not mounted error

2008-03-17 Thread Launchpad Bug Tracker
This bug was fixed in the package nautilus - 1:2.22.0-0ubuntu3

---
nautilus (1:2.22.0-0ubuntu3) hardy; urgency=low

  * debian/patches/90_from_svn_mount_connect_to_server_locations.patch:
- change from svn, mounts location in the connect to server dialog
  (lp: #198531)

 -- Sebastien Bacher [EMAIL PROTECTED]   Mon, 17 Mar 2008 13:55:36
+0100
